I have had two stomas - the one that seems to have worked is on my right side, right at my waistline. "At rest," it is about 1 1/2 inches in diameter and sticks out about the same (grows when active). I remarked to my doc that if I were a man and my stoma were a penis, I would almost be proud. (He didn't laugh - I guess guys don't like those kind of jokes). Anyway, after two surgeries, I have a huge scar running down the middle of my abdomen. The side the stoma is on seems to be much bigger (in terms of sticking out) than the other side and when you add the stoma and the bag, I think it is incredibly visible. I wear tops and vests and sweaters that are huge and are long enough to cover the whole mess. I just hate it. I miss wearing nice clothes...but I can't wear pants with a waistline because it goes right across the stoma and I am just so self-conscious. The thing I miss the most is swimming...I don't think I will ever feel comfortable enough to wear a swimming suit again. Anyone have any suggestions that have worked for you?
